The dazzling Shanghai Grand Theatre sits in the northwest of People’s Square. It was designed
by a French architect, originally built in 1928.
The theatre appears to made almost entirely from glass. it consists of 3 theatres for performing opera, ballet, symphony, chamber music, stage play and dance drama. It is equipped with an automatic mechanical stage, the largest and most advanced in Asia.
The roof of the theatre is an upturned arc, resembling a treasure bowl and said to symbolize Shanghai's openness and progressive spirit. A immense chandelier id suspended from the ceiling of the theatre which sparkles and glistens across the entire square.
